What you will be doing:

As VP of Sales, North America, you will lead our go-to-market strategy, scale a high-performing sales organization, and drive significant revenue growth across new and existing accounts. You will coach, mentor, and inspire a team of sales professionals (6–12 direct reports) while collaborating closely with executive leadership to expand our market share in IBM i modernization, cloud transformation, and managed services.  Travel to client locations required.
You’ll bring structure, accountability, and energy to Fresche’s North American sales function — ensuring that every team member is aligned with our growth objectives and empowered to succeed.

Responsibilities:

  • Lead, develop, and inspire a team of high-performing Account Executives and Sales Directors across North America.
  • Own the sales strategy, execution, and performance against annual revenue targets across multiple product lines.
  • Build a repeatable sales operating model — including forecasting, pipeline management, and performance measurement.
  • Drive both direct and indirect sales, including strategic alliances, channel partners, and enterprise accounts, ensuring a balanced and scalable growth approach.
  • Collaborate with Marketing, Delivery, and Transformation teams to ensure cohesive go-to-market execution and consistent client experience.
  • Partner with the Executive Leadership Team to shape pricing, incentives, and territory strategy that support company-wide profitability goals.
  • Lead enterprise-level deal negotiations and establish executive relationships with key clients and partners.
  • Foster a results-oriented, collaborative sales culture grounded in accountability, transparency, and customer success.
  • Identify and act on new market opportunities within modernization, cloud, and managed services ecosystems.
  • Provide strategic insights and feedback to guide product and service innovation.

Qualifications:

  • 15+ years of progressive sales leadership experience, including at least 5 years in a senior or executive role overseeing multi-rep teams across North America.
  • Demonstrated success driving multi-million-dollar annual revenue growth in enterprise B2B technology or managed services sectors.
  • Proven ability to build and lead a sales team of 10 or more high-performing professionals.
  • Experience in the IBM i / AS/400 modernization, cloud, or enterprise software markets is highly desirable.
  • Strong financial and analytical acumen, with experience managing forecasts, quotas, and sales operations metrics.
  • Excellent communication, executive presence, and negotiation skills.
  • Ability to collaborate cross-functionally and work effectively in a dynamic, remote-first environment.
  • Direct experience with the MEDDIC (or equivalent) selling methodologies

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
